All local Pakistani football teams will be getting a chance to represent Pakistan in Red Bull Neymar Jr.’s Five World Finals in Brazil, as the local tryouts for teams from Karachi, Lahore and Islamabad get ready to battle it out in the fields between 16th and 25th May.
The country qualifiers for Pakistan will kick off in Karachi, before moving on to Lahore and Islamabad. Once the tryouts are done, the top teams from each city will face-off in the national qualifiers in Lahore on May 25th, thus getting a chance to represent the country in the Red Bull Neymar Jr.’s Five World Finals in Brazil. To get a chance to enter this competition, the teams can simply sign up and register themselves by logging onto http://www.redbullneymarjrsfive.com any time till May 13th.
The competition is based solely on the concept of survival of the fittest. Both males and females will be allowed to play together in a team, based purely on their skills and technique. A majority of the team’s players should be between the age of 16 and 25 years. The rules of the game include two parts: Two teams of no more than five players will play against each other for 10 minutes, without any goalkeepers, and every time a team scores, the opposing side would lose one of their players.
Red Bull Neymar Jr.’s Five is a tournament aimed to unite players from all around the world to celebrate football. In 2018, over 125,000 players from 62 countries signed up for the tryouts, and the tournament in 2019 is expected to be equally huge, if not a bigger deal.

KARACHI: Matloob Ahmed is perhaps in the best form of his life but the Lahore professional is confident that he can do even better after triumphing in the Chevron-DHA Karachi Cup All Pakistan Open Golf Championship here recently at the Defence Authority Country and Golf Club.
Matloob, who has been in terrific form since the start of this year, was in full flow as he won the Chevron-DHA Open by four strokes ahead of Pakistan No. 1 Shabbir Iqbal.
“I’m in great form and hope that with more hard work I will continue doing well on the national circuit,” Matloob said.
Matloob’s sights are now firmly set on the US$300,000 CNS Open – an Asian Tour tournament – which will be played in Karachi in July this year.
“It’s the biggest event to be held in Pakistan in more than ten years and I will try to give my best in it,” he said.
Meanwhile, Pakistan’s rising youngster Ahmed Baig won the amateur title in the DHA-Chenvron Open and then vowed to win more laurels in the future.
“I’m gaining confidence after every tournament and hopefully I will do even better in the coming events,” he said.
Almost all of Pakistan’s top players featured in the prestigious tournament which carried at stake a total prize purse of Rs3.5 million. The tournament was played from May 10-13 with the main professional event taking place over 54 holes.
Top professionals and amateurs from all over the country were part of the stellar cast of the tournament sponsored by Chevron Pakistan Lubricants (Private) Limited, a manufacturer and distributor of premium lubricants in Pakistan. This tournament is a unique yearly event of Pakistan Golf Federation calendar, which is counted among the most prestigious golf events in Pakistan. More than 200 golfers featured in the tournament including leading professionals and amateurs of the country. Other events which were played during the tournament included Senior Professionals, Seniors, Veterans, Ladies, Juniors and Masters.

Life events such as childbirth, weight fluctuation and hormonal changes may overstretch and damage the vaginal tissue and the pelvic floor as well as alter the mucosal tone of the vaginal wall. These changes can lead to urinary incontinence, vaginal atrophy, dryness and can cause recurring infections all of which have a potential effect on the quality of life and self-confidence of women as 3D lifestyle believes that SHE MATTERS!
3D V-JUVE is the ultimate three-dimensional solution providing a minimally invasive procedure. The 3D V-JUVE fractional CO2 laser delivers superficial energy into the vaginal skin which creates tiny white ablated dots of damaged tissue on the mucosal lining of the vaginal canal. The resulting heating response stimulates new collagen production improving the thickness of the vaginal lining. In addition to the vaginal tightening, the fractional CO2 application can also be used for vulva rejuvenation and skin resurfacing.
